Bernard Li is a highly experienced physical therapist and consultant currently serving as a Physical Therapist Consultant for the Los Angeles Lakers and a Major League Physical Therapist at the Los Angeles Dodgers. As the Head of Rehabilitation for the Dodgers since December 2021, Bernard contributes significant expertise to athlete care. Additionally, Bernard has been an Adjunct Faculty member and Physical Therapist at the University of Southern California since 2004. Previous roles include Advisor for Athlete Care and Medical Services for the Seattle Mariners and Director of Player Performance and Sports Science for the Los Angeles Angels. Education includes a Doctor of Physical Therapy from the University of Southern California and a Bachelor's of Science in Molecular Physiology from UC Santa Barbara.

The Los Angeles Dodgers are a professional baseball team based in Los Angeles, California. The Dodgers are members of the National League West division of Major League Baseball (MLB). The team originated in Brooklyn, New York, where it was known by a number of nicknames before becoming the Dodgers definitively by 1932. The team moved to Los Angeles before the 1958 season. They played their first four seasons in Los Angeles at the Los Angeles Memorial Coliseum before moving to their current home of Dodger Stadium, the third-oldest ballpark in Major League Baseball (trailing Fenway Park and Wrigley Field).
